I am working with a very specific mp3 file trying to get all the metadata from it using format parser gem and I got the following error (StringIO throwing on read):
ruby/gems/2.7.0/gems/id3tag-0.14.1/lib/id3tag/audio_file.rb:53:in `read': negative length -1430667650 given (ArgumentError)
Unfortunately, I cannot share the file within this issue (as I am not the author) and I simply cannot recreate a file with the breaking scenario.
The problem is originated in the id3tag gem and I got it fixed a few days ago with this: krists/id3tag#31
Proposal
update the id3tag gem from version v0.14 to >= v0.14.2
